diff options
Diffstat (limited to 'src/components/sun.jsx')
-rw-r--r-- | src/components/sun.jsx | 18 |
1 files changed, 18 insertions, 0 deletions
diff --git a/src/components/sun.jsx b/src/components/sun.jsx new file mode 100644 index 0000000..455a065 --- /dev/null +++ b/src/components/sun.jsx @@ -0,0 +1,18 @@ +import { Matrix4 } from 'three'; +import * as everforest from '../_everforest.module.scss' + +export default function Sun() { + return (<> + <directionalLight + position={[1000, 1000, 1000]} + lookAt={[0, 0, 0]} + intensity={Math.PI / 2} + color={everforest.red} + /> + <ambientLight intensity={Math.PI / 4} /> + <mesh position={[1000,1000,1000]}> + <icosahedronGeometry args={[100,100]}/> + <meshStandardMaterial color={everforest.red} emissive={everforest.red} emissiveIntensity={1} fog={false}/> + </mesh> + </>); +} |